Job Description

Position Summary : This full-time research assistant position is part of the Mood, Emotion, and Development Lab housed in the Department of Psychology and Human Development at Peabody College at Vanderbilt University and is responsible for coordinating a clinical research study on predictors of adolescent suicidal behaviors after psychiatric hospitalization. Primary responsibilities will be recruiting and retaining research participants in acute psychiatric care, administering electroencephalogram (EEG) assessments, administering interviews to assess histories of suicidal thoughts/behaviors and implementing safety protocols, and ensuring complete and accurate data entry. The research assistant will report to the lab manager and lab director. The ideal start date for this position is May 18, 2026.
About the Work Unit : The mission of the Mood, Emotion, and Development Lab is to promote mental health and reduce the burden of mood disorders on children, adolescents, parents, and families. Our team is united in our values of rigorous science, teaching and mentorship, collaboration, and community engagement, welcoming diverse ideas and perspectives in an increasingly evolving society. Key Functions and Expected Performance:
  • Recruit and retain research participants in acute psychiatric care

  • Lead electroencephalogram (EEG) assessments

  • Administer interviews to assess histories of suicidal thoughts/behaviors

  • Implement safety protocols

  • Train students in study procedures and lab expectations

  • Check data for accuracy and completeness

  • Monitor and document payments made to research participants

  • Maintain organization of lab spaces and lab servers

Supervisory Relationships : This position does not have supervisory responsibility; this position reports administratively and functionally to the Lab Manager.
Education and Certifications:
  • A bachelor’s degree in psychology, neuroscience, cognitive studies, child studies, counseling, social work or a related field is required.

  • A master’s degree in psychology, neuroscience, cognitive studies, child studies, counseling, social work or a related field is preferred.

Experience and Skills :
  • Previous research experience working with human subjects is required .

  • Experience working with children and families is required .

  • Experience recruiting and scheduling participants is preferred .

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office is necessary .

  • Experience training others is preferred .

  • Experience with EEG methods is preferred .

  • Experience administering clinical assessments and safety protocols is preferred .

  • Experience with and detailed knowledge of REDCap is preferred.

Key Characteristics of a Successful Team Member in this Work Unit:
  • Attention to detail

  • Flexibility with regards to planning and scheduling

  • Strong organization and planning skills

  • Strong interpersonal skills

  • Ability to interact positively with research participants and fellow lab members

Availability for study sessions on evenings and weekends
